Well Besweet says it can convert OGG to other formats but I guess the problem lies with Besweet. You can try it yourself. Download a OGG gile from www.vorbis.com and try to convert it to other format like MP2 using Besweet and its GUI, it crashes everytime. Maybe the problem lies with the vorbis DLL, I have version 1.0.
